> There is quite a mess in the Tier 1 servers currently, which I think
> needs to be addressed. ALL of the following servers are marked as
> offline due to no response or very limited response. The big question
> here is, if the owners don't respond and get their servers back online,
> should we consider dropping these TLDs?
>
> NS3 (since Jan 2019) .neo -- neo
> This one is disabled, I assume they meant to come back? The last zone
> update was in 2017.
>
> NS5 (offline since Apr 2024) -- verax
> No TLDs, this was just an extra T1 server in the Netherlands.
>
> NS9 (since Apr 2025) .o -- jonaharagon
> NS11 (since Apr 2024) .o -- jonaharagon
> Last zone update was 2024 and there are ZERO domains listed. Waiting to
> see if he responds on IRC.
>
> NS10 (since Dec 2025) .null and .oz -- mars
> Seems to be resolving all TLDs except their own. Both TLD zones was
> last updated in December and have an extensive list of domains. This one
> is probably still alive and just needs some admin intervention.
>
> NS12 (since Jun 2020) .cyb -- sy, albino
> The last zone update was in 2019. There is a decent list of domains
> registered, but I don't know if anyone still uses them?
>
> NS13 (since Oct 2023) .epic -- okashi_o
> I believe the last zone update for .epic was in 2020. Again, no idea if
> anyone is still using these domains.
>
> NS14 (since Jun 2024) .chan -- OWNER UNKNOWN
> The last zone update for .chan was in 2019
>
> So at the very least, we should have a discussion about removing or
> re-homing .neo, .cyb, .epic, and .chan. If there is still interest in
> these TLDs I can always add them to the registration server at be.libre
> or someone else can take over, but this would require all current domain
> owners to claim their domains so they could be re-registered from the
> new host.
>
> In addition, we should have a vote about removing peering with
> NewNations (ti uu te ku rm ko) since they have been broken for several
> years now. Does anyone have any discussion about that before I start a
> new thread to being voting?
>
> The same applies for peering Emercoin (bazar coin emc lib). I don't see
> that those domains are responding either, so I believe they should be
> removed. Again, is there any discussion about this peer before I start
> a vote?
